What is a Vendor Relationship Management System?

In today’s business landscape, where partnerships and collaborations are vital for success, a Vendor Relationship Management System (VRMS) is like the secret ingredient that keeps everything running smoothly. But what exactly is a VRMS?

At its core, a VRMS is a digital platform or software solution designed to help businesses manage their relationships with vendors effectively. It serves as a centralized hub where all vendor-related information can be stored, accessed, and analyzed in real-time. From initial onboarding to ongoing communication and performance evaluation, a VRMS streamlines every aspect of vendor management.

By leveraging technology to automate manual processes and consolidate data from various sources, businesses can gain unparalleled visibility into their vendor ecosystem. They can track key metrics such as contract terms, pricing agreements, delivery schedules, service level agreements (SLAs), and performance indicators all in one place. This eliminates the need for spreadsheets or disparate systems that often lead to inefficiencies and missed opportunities.

With a VRMS in place, businesses can foster stronger collaboration with vendors by facilitating seamless communication channels. The system allows for instant messaging capabilities or dedicated portals where both parties can exchange information securely. This not only improves transparency but also enables faster issue resolution and better decision-making.

One of the most significant advantages of using a VRMS is the ability to analyze vendor performance comprehensively. By capturing data related to deliverables, quality metrics, responsiveness levels, and customer satisfaction ratings within the system itself – businesses gain valuable insights into their vendors’ strengths and weaknesses.

This data-driven approach empowers organizations to make informed decisions when it comes to selecting new vendors or renegotiating contracts with existing ones based on objective criteria rather than intuition alone.

The Benefits of a VRMS

The Benefits of a VRMS

A Vendor Relationship Management System (VRMS) can bring numerous benefits to your business. One of the main advantages is improved efficiency and streamlined operations. With a VRMS in place, you can easily manage all vendor-related activities, such as onboarding new vendors, tracking performance metrics, and monitoring compliance.

Another benefit of using a VRMS is enhanced communication between your company and its vendors. The system provides a centralized platform where both parties can exchange information, collaborate on projects, and resolve any issues that may arise. This helps to foster stronger relationships with your vendors and ensures everyone is working towards common goals.

Furthermore, a VRMS enables better risk management by providing real-time visibility into vendor data. You can track key metrics like delivery times, quality ratings, and contract compliance to identify potential risks or areas for improvement. By proactively addressing these issues, you can minimize disruptions to your supply chain and maintain high levels of customer satisfaction.

In addition to operational efficiencies and risk management capabilities, implementing a VRMS also offers financial benefits. By optimizing vendor selection processes based on performance data captured in the system, you can negotiate more favorable pricing terms with top-performing suppliers. This not only reduces costs but also improves overall profitability for your business.

How to Implement a VRMS

Implementing a Vendor Relationship Management System (VRMS) in your organization can be a game-changer when it comes to streamlining operations and enhancing collaboration with your vendors. Here are some steps to help you successfully implement a VRMS.

First, clearly define your objectives and goals for implementing the system. Identify what specific areas of vendor management you want to improve, such as tracking contract expiration dates or automating purchase order processes.

Next, conduct thorough research to find the right VRMS provider that aligns with your business needs. Look for features like vendor database management, contract management, performance tracking, and integration capabilities with other software systems.

Once you’ve selected a VRMS vendor, involve key stakeholders from various departments in the implementation process. This ensures buy-in from all relevant parties and helps tailor the system to meet their specific requirements.

Before launching the system across your organization, provide comprehensive training sessions for employees who will be using the VRMS regularly. This will ensure they understand how to navigate through its functionalities effectively.

During implementation, consider piloting the system in one department or with a select group of vendors before rolling it out company-wide. This allows for testing and fine-tuning before full-scale deployment.

Regularly evaluate the effectiveness of your VRMS by monitoring key performance metrics related to vendor management efficiency and cost savings achieved. Make necessary adjustments as needed based on feedback from users and ongoing analysis of data collected by the system.

Features of a Good VRMS

Features of a Good VRMS

A good Vendor Relationship Management System (VRMS) should have a range of features to help streamline and enhance your operations. Here are some key features that you should look for when choosing a VRMS:

1. Centralized Database: A good VRMS will provide a centralized database where all vendor information can be stored and accessed easily. This includes contact details, contracts, performance data, and any other relevant documents.

2. Contract Management: The system should offer robust contract management capabilities, allowing you to create, store, track, and manage vendor contracts efficiently. This feature helps ensure compliance with contractual agreements and reduces the risk of missed deadlines or penalties.

3. Performance Tracking: An effective VRMS should enable you to track vendor performance through real-time analytics and reporting functionalities. This allows you to evaluate vendors based on key metrics such as quality, delivery timeframes, customer satisfaction ratings, etc.

4. Communication Tools: Look for a VRMS that offers communication tools such as messaging systems or notifications within the platform itself. These features facilitate seamless communication between your organization and its vendors.

5. Integration Capabilities: A good VRMS should integrate well with other software systems used in your organization like accounting software or inventory management tools. This integration ensures smooth data flow between different departments within your company.

6.

Security Measures: It is crucial that the VRMS has robust security measures in place to protect sensitive vendor data from unauthorized access or breaches.

The Top 5 VRMS Vendors

The market for vendor relationship management systems (VRMS) is rapidly growing, with numerous vendors competing to offer the best solutions. Here are five of the top VRMS vendors that businesses can consider:

1. Vendorful: Known for its user-friendly interface and powerful features, Vendorful provides a comprehensive VRMS solution. It offers features such as contract lifecycle management, automated vendor onboarding, and real-time collaboration tools. Vendorful also integrates seamlessly with popular third-party applications.

2. Scout RFP: This cloud-based VRMS platform helps streamline procurement processes by providing efficient sourcing and supplier management capabilities. With its intuitive dashboard and AI-powered analytics, Scout RFP enables organizations to make data-driven decisions while reducing costs and improving efficiency.

3. Ivalua: Ivalua’s end-to-end VRMS solution caters to both large enterprises and mid-sized businesses. Its robust functionality includes spend analysis, supplier performance management, and risk mitigation tools. Ivalua’s platform is highly customizable to meet specific business needs.

4. SAP Ariba: As part of the SAP suite of products, Ariba offers a comprehensive set of procurement solutions including their VRMS offering called Ariba Network+. It allows organizations to connect with a vast network of suppliers globally while providing features like contract management and compliance monitoring.

5 . Coupa: Coupa’s all-in-one platform combines various procurement functionalities into one cohesive system including contract negotiation, purchasing automation, invoice processing, and expense tracking.

This makes it an attractive option for organizations looking for an integrated approach to vendor relationship management.

How to Choose the Right VRMS for Your Business

When it comes to choosing the right VRMS for your business, there are several factors you need to consider. First and foremost, assess your specific needs and requirements. What are you looking to achieve with a vendor relationship management system? Are you focused on streamlining communication, improving collaboration, or enhancing efficiency in vendor interactions?

Next, evaluate the features and capabilities of different VRMS vendors. Look for key functionalities such as contract management, performance tracking, document sharing, and analytics. Consider how these features align with your business goals and objectives.

It’s also important to factor in scalability. As your business grows and evolves, will the chosen VRMS be able to accommodate increased data volume and user demands? Make sure that the system is flexible enough to adapt to future changes without causing disruption.

Furthermore, take into account integration capabilities with existing systems. Will the VRMS seamlessly integrate with other tools or platforms used within your organization? This can help avoid duplication of efforts and ensure a smooth workflow.

Consider the reputation and customer reviews of potential vendors. Look for testimonials from businesses similar in size or industry to yours who have successfully implemented their VRMS solutions.

Lastly but importantly , carefully analyze pricing models offered by different vendors. Determine whether they offer a subscription-based model or if there are additional costs involved such as implementation fees or ongoing support charges.
